Transaction 658526150540deb9a817e50878fdd9005c47651ed45b36a610c3bca4d81f0e49

2 Input
2 Outputs
  • 658526150540deb9a817e50878fdd9005c47651ed45b36a610c3bca4d81f0e49:0
  • value  3887120
    address  18QCLvDNR6xxG85H51Kpo6odpfFaHP3eau
  • 658526150540deb9a817e50878fdd9005c47651ed45b36a610c3bca4d81f0e49:1
  • value  5547289
    address  3QmAAf4SsVJMyMKHiSi6hWvQjknLghBnAx